python-django-anymail - 5.0-1 main

Anymail integrates several transactional email service providers (ESPs) into
Django, with a consistent API that lets you use ESP-added features without
locking your code to a particular ESP.
.
It currently fully supports Amazon SES (requires python-boto3), Mailgun,
Mailjet, Postmark, SendinBlue, SendGrid, and SparkPost, and has limited
support for Mandrill
.
Anymail normalizes ESP functionality so it "just works" with Django's
built-in `django.core.mail` package. It includes:
.
* Support for HTML, attachments, extra headers, and other features of
Django's built-in email
* Extensions that make it easy to use extra ESP functionality, like tags,
metadata, and tracking, with code that's portable between ESPs
* Simplified inline images for HTML email
* Normalized sent-message status and tracking notification, by connecting
your ESP's webhooks to Django signals
* "Batch transactional" sends using your ESP's merge and template features
.
This is the Python 2 version of the package.
